In 1810, Nancy M Cotton entered the world in Wilkes County, Georgia, USA, born to Weaver Alexander Cotton Sr And Sarah Elizabeth Bennett. Nancy M Cotton passed away in 1855 in Coweta County, Georgia, USA.
